We have enough funds for approximately 15 murals. We are in the final stages of planning the venues at Williamsburg Landing (September 24th), Eastern State (September 26th) and the College of William & Mary (September 26-27). The keynote PaintFest is scheduled for Thursday September 25th at 3:00 PM at the Williamsburg Lodge.
John Feight, Hospital Arts Founder, and his son, Scott, will be joining us on September 24th. We are planning a Paintfest for our club prior to that dinner presentation.
For planning purposes, one mural takes 12 people about 2 hours to complete. We are planning to have more people paint for 5-15 minutes each thereby letting more people involved in the experience.
